Java는 백기선님의 유튜브를 통해 공부한다. 목표 자바의 Class에 대해 학습하세요. 학습할 것 (필수) 클래스 정의하는 방법 객체 만드는 방법 (new 키워드 이해하기) 메소드 정의하는 방법 생성자 정의하는 방법 this 키워드 이해하기 클래스 정의하는 방법 Ref 클래스의 개념 객체 지향 프로그래밍(OOP, Object-Oriented Programming) 객체 지향 프로그래밍에서는 모든 데이터를 객체(object)로 취급하는데, 객체(object)는 대개 붕어빵으로 비유된다. 이러한 객체(붕어빵)의 상태와 행동을 구체화하는 형태의 프로그래밍이 바로 객체 지향 프로그래밍이다. 클래스(class) 자바에서 클래스(class)란 객체를 정의하는 틀(붕어빵틀)과 같다. 클래스는 객체의 상태를 나타내는..

Java는 백기선님의 유튜브를 통해 공부한다. 목표 자바가 제공하는 제어문을 학습하세요. 학습할 것 선택문(필수) 반복문(필수) 선택문 Ref Java 언어에서는 특정 데이터의 값에 따라 수행할 구문을 선택하는 문법을 제공한다. 이와 같은 문법을 일반적으로 선택문이라 부르며 switch case문이라고도 부른다. switch(변수){ // 변수 입력 case 상수: //타입에 맞는 상수가 오면 해당 케이스 실행 statment; break; //실행시 break되며 다음 case무시 후 swtich 벗어남 //break가 없으면 아래 모든 case와 default 실행 case 상수: //이전 case에 속하지 않으면 다른 case에 접근 statment; break; default: //모든 case에..
Java는 백기선님의 유튜브를 통해 공부한다. 목표 자바가 제공하는 다양한 연산자를 학습하세요. 학습할 것 산술 연산자 비트 연산자 관계 연산자 논리 연산자 instanceof assignment(=) operator 화살표(->) 연산자 3항 연산자 연산자 우선 순위 (optional) Java 13. switch 연산자 연산자(Operater) Ref Ref 연산자는 하나, 둘 또는 세 개의 피연산자에 대해 특정 연산을 수행한 다음 결과를 반환하는 특수 기호이다. 연산자는 각 기호별로 다양한 연산자들이 존재하는데 수학의 연산자들중 곱셈을 덧셈보다 먼저하듯이 각 연산자끼리의 연산 우선 순위가 정해져있다. 연산자 우선 순위 최우선 연산자 ( ) : 우선순위 변경을 위해사용 [ ] : 배열의 크기나 첨자를..
Java는 백기선님의 유튜브를 통해 공부한다. 목표 자바의 프리미티브 타입, 변수 그리고 배열을 사용하는 방법을 익힙니다. 학습할 것 프리미티브 타입과 레퍼런스 타입 리터럴 변수 선언 및 초기화하는 방법 변수의 스코프와 라이프타임 타입 변환, 캐스팅 그리고 타입 프로모션 1차 및 2차 배열 선언하기 타입 추론, var #프리미티브 타입과 레퍼런스 타입 Ref 데이터에는 다양한 타입이 존재한다. 그 중 자바의 데이터값의 타입들은 다음과 같이 나눠진다. 자바 데이터타입 (ref 뇌를자극하는 Java 프로그래밍 - 한빛미디어) 프리미티브 타입 타입 할당되는 메모리 크기 기본값 데이터의 표현 범위 논리형 boolean 1 byte false true, false 정수형 byte 1 byte 0 -128 ~ 12..
- Total
- Today
- Yesterday
- Coding
- 접근제한자
- extends
- JVM
- 큐플레이
- JSP
- 선택문
- Java Web
- aws
- 생성자
- 제어문
- 코딩
- JavaScript
- nohup
- HTTPS
- TSC
- Tkinter
- 자바
- Java
- 반복문
- 인스턴스
- error
- 접근지시자
- javaee
- typescript
- Modifying
- 메소드
- 1인개발
- 메소드 디스패치
- 파이썬게임
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| ||||
4 | 5 | 6 | 7 | 8 | 9 | 10 |
11 | 12 | 13 | 14 | 15 | 16 | 17 |
18 | 19 | 20 | 21 | 22 | 23 | 24 |
25 | 26 | 27 | 28 | 29 | 30 | 31 |